[autotest] Add sudo -n option to avoid password prompt.

Also add a utility function to check if password is needed to run sudo command.

We can add -n option to all sudo command that SSP used. However, once the
property drone.support_ssp is set to False, no SSP code will be executed.
Therefore, there is no need to add -n everywhere.

BUG=chromium:484396
TEST=local run
Start scheduler, confirm no password promt, and drone.support_ssp is False.
Run sudo true, enter password.
Run scheduler again, confirm no password promt, and drone.support_ssp is True.
